Role Overview
This role focuses on the detailed design and simulation of superconducting qubits and circuit elements used in quantum processors.
Key Responsibilities
- Design superconducting qubits, resonators, and couplers
- Perform electromagnetic and circuit-level simulations
- Optimize designs for coherence, tunability, and fabrication yield
- Analyze loss mechanisms and noise sources
- Collaborate with fabrication and measurement teams
- MSc or PhD in Physics, Electrical Engineering, or related field
- Experience with superconducting circuits and microwave design
- Familiarity with EM simulation tools (HFSS, Sonnet, COMSOL, etc.)
